Williamstown commission authorizes $1,325 repair of 25 headstones in Village Cemetery

Williamstown Cemetery Commission · April 23,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

The Williamstown Cemetery Commission on April 23 approved a $1,325 contract for repair of 25 headstones in the Village Cemetery and noted remaining funds in the stone-repair and maintenance budgets.

The Williamstown Cemetery Commission approved a contract to repair 25 headstones in the Village Cemetery during its April 23 meeting. Susan Lyons moved to authorize the work and Matt Walker seconded; the motion was approved with all present agreeing.

Joe Mangan, who offered to perform the work, told commissioners, "I can do 25 stones for $1,325.00." The commission noted there is $2,000 remaining in the stone replacement/repair budget and $2,000 left in the maintenance budget, and recorded the contractor authorization for follow-up at the next meeting.
